Why Clamp-On Ferrite Chokes Are Necessary
I use clamp-on ferrite chokes because they are one of the simplest ways to reduce unwanted electrical noise on cables. When I notice interference causing problems like audio hiss, screen flicker, or unstable device performance, a ferrite choke helps suppress high-frequency noise without requiring any complicated installation. It is a quick fix that can make a real difference.
My experience has shown me that these chokes are especially useful for protecting sensitive electronics from electromagnetic interference. They work by absorbing and reducing noise that travels along power cords, USB cables, HDMI cables, and other signal lines. This helps keep my devices running more smoothly and can improve the reliability of the entire setup.
I also like that clamp-on ferrite chokes are easy to add or remove whenever needed. I do not have to cut cables or make permanent changes, which makes them a practical choice for both home and office use. For me, they are a low-cost and effective solution when I want cleaner signals and fewer interference issues.

Choosing the Right Size
One of the first things I check is the cable diameter. I have learned that a ferrite choke only works well if it fits the cable properly. If it is too loose, it may not stay in place or perform effectively. If it is too tight, it may not close properly around the cable. I always measure the cable before buying so I can match the inner diameter of the choke correctly.
Checking the Ferrite Material
I pay attention to the ferrite material because it affects how well the choke suppresses noise. Different materials work better for different frequency ranges. In my experience, a good-quality ferrite core makes a noticeable difference in performance. If I am buying for general use, I look for products that clearly mention their noise suppression capability and intended frequency range.

Single vs. Multiple Turns
When possible, I consider whether the cable can pass through the choke more than once. In some cases, looping the cable through the ferrite core can improve noise suppression. Of course, this depends on the cable thickness and the choke size. I usually check the product instructions to see whether the design supports one pass or multiple turns.
